Candidate for President

 

Assed BaigAssed Baig

 
For far too long our students’ union has not involved the very students it is meant to represent. It has been run by various cliques, who mired in bureaucracy do nothing but wait for their pay cheques each month. There are over 15,000 students at Staffs, and the vast majority do not have a say in the running of the union. WE must fight together for a strong, democratic and campaigning union.
 
I am an experienced campaigner and activist and have been involved in grassroots campaigns both on and off campus, opposing war and occupation with the Stop the War Coalition, fighting for a free education and campaigning against racism. Our union should be the place that organises students to take part in these campaigns.
 
Most union decisions made by the union happen at Student Council, to which most students do not know how to submit policy. I want to open up our council, by publicising it around campus and bringing in activists to share their experience and expertise with us at Staffs. Our council should be the place students come together to fight on the issues that affect us most, like the biggest challenge facing humanity – climate change, the rise of fascists like the BNP and the attacks on our education.
 
If elected I will campaign:
  • For a free education for all.
  • For more Fair Trade products and an ethical union.
  • Against the BNP.
  • Against climate change and more bike sheds on campus.
  • An end to excessive library fees.
  • For a Shisha lounge on both campuses
 
The time has come for change at Staffs; our Students’ Union should be a place where all students can come and voice their opinions and where they can campaign about the issues they care about most. My door will always be open, and I want to reach out to students who may not have been involved before. Students are part of the wider world and we should fight for a world that is free from war and oppression.
